Huntington Theatre Company Adds 'M' Performance, 4/28

By:

Due to popular demand, the Huntington Theatre Company has added a performance of Ryan Landry's "M" on Sunday, April 28 at 2pm. Known for his blending of classic source material with his unique brands of comedy and imaginative theatricality, Landry (Mildred Fierce) transforms Fritz Lang's 1931 film iconic film about a city panicked by an elusive child killer into a surreal, screwball take that is both hilarious and heart-stirring. The production began previews on March 30 and opens tonight.

Landry is the founder of the Gold Dust Orphans and the creative force behind such acclaimed reimaginings of classics as Mildred Fierce, Death of a Saleslady, Pussy on the House, A T-Stop Named Denial, and The Little Pricks. "With Ryan Landry, perversity and hilarity go skipping along hand in hand," says Boston.com.
